QUOTE(Stanic1990 @ Jan 4 2016, 03:45 AM) According to mah sing, this is stage 2a late payment charges which means if you are getting 90% loan, the process of releasing the payment from rhb to mah sing was late. I have the same issues like you, and you need to write in ask for waiver. I did it but lousy mah sing customer service never responseded my email until I called to follow up again. The lady who is arranging for key collection, Soo Lee told me that mah sing will definitely waive it but because they have thousands purchasers so not able to reply each email, what an excuse! Besides, she told me my LAD cheque will only be ready before CNY. My VP date was 4dec and lad payment is calculated until 4dec 2015, though till today I have not gotten mine 😖 1 more thing to highlight is that, my bank charge me interest which covered the period before VP date, I called up mah sing, and Soo Lee, the same lady told me that we can claim back the interest charge from our bank before the vp date and she referred me to another Malay lady who is in charge of billing. I have been calling the Malay lady last week, line was either engaged or no response ... Very hard to get to call mah sing.. My opionin is that if you need to get the interest portion charged from mah sing, suggest you get your back to print out the breakdown of that month's interest and email to mah sing. I'm asking my bank to send me the breakdown already, estimated can get back around rm250... just to update; mahsing will waive the late payment. ive only been asked to pay the quit rent, and the future maintenance charges (no idea why to collect now) i have about 400-500rm of interest from bank. will ask them while i collect the key.
